FANDANGO MEDIA H-1B Visa Sponsorship & Salary Data
FANDANGO MEDIA has filed 94 H-1B labor condition applications from FY 2020 to FY 2025, with 90 certified. The median H-1B salary at FANDANGO MEDIA is $149,781, which is 25% higher than the national H-1B median of $120,000.
Salary Analysis
Salary Range
- 10th percentile: $109,429
- 25th percentile: $123,085
- Median: $149,781
- 75th percentile: $160,000
- 90th percentile: $180,500
Wage Level Distribution
- Level I (Entry): 3 (4%)
- Level II (Qualified): 21 (28%)
- Level III (Experienced): 13 (17%)
- Level IV (Expert): 39 (51%)
Trend (2020-2025)
- Starting median: $151,500
- Current median: $149,781
- Growth: -1%

What wage level does FANDANGO MEDIA use for H-1B?
FANDANGO MEDIA primarily files H-1B applications at Wage Level IV, accounting for 51% of their filings. DOL wage levels range from Level I (entry-level, 17th percentile of local wages) to Level IV (expert, 67th percentile). Wage level determines both salary requirements and, under recent H-1B rules, lottery selection priority. Higher wage levels receive preference in the H-1B lottery, making FANDANGO MEDIA's wage level distribution an important factor for prospective applicants assessing their chances of H-1B selection.
With 96% of positions at Level II or higher, FANDANGO MEDIA typically offers competitive wages above entry-level. Higher wage levels receive priority in the H-1B lottery.
